Giant Step & Revive Da Live Present the Third Installment of CHURCH with Mark de Clive-Lowe
Friday, January 6 2012
Drom, New York NY
|
event description
World-renowned DJ, Producer, Remixer, Composer, Musician, and Tru Thoughts recording artist Mark de Clive-Lowe (MdCL), joined by Nate Smith (Betty Carter/Dave Holland) on Drums and Mark Kelley (The Roots) on bass, with special guest nia andrews on vocals and DJ Raydar.
Mark de Clive-Lowe continues to build on the success of his new CHURCH monthly series in New York at DROM. CHURCH is a whirlwind mix of live jazz, sampling and a DJ set. Fast becoming the discerning music-lovers’ and musicians’ event of choice, don’t be surprised if you spot the likes of Master at Work Louie Vega or soul legend Leon Ware in the audience; Chris “Daddy” Dave, MC John Robinson or Miguel Atwood-Ferguson on the stage and the likes of Ge-ology on the decks. The first live set showcases the jazz side of MdCL, blending standards, groove explorations and classic trio interplay with resampling, electronics and live remixing. As the first set draws to a close, the guest DJ takes over the soundtrack while the tables and chairs are cleared away ready for MdCL to flip the script with the second set—a unique blend of live electronica and live remixing—the jazz club colliding head to head with the dance floor.
